nginx怎麼配置部分頁面使用https

2021-03-19 18:21:59 字數 3204 閱讀 9042

1樓:匿名使用者

首先配置好https,不要設定301或者302跳轉,然後設定自定義頁面跳轉https就可以了。

跳轉方式很多,nginx 自動跳轉到

nginx 怎麼配置一個用https 一個用http

2樓:匿名使用者

檢視ngixn ssl證書配置指南,配置ssl證書後,開啟80埠和443埠,那麼http和https 都是可以訪問的。

nginx 怎麼配置 https 跳轉到另外一個**

3樓:匿名使用者

nginx 自動跳轉到https:網頁連結

可根據教程指定到需要的地址。

4樓:匿名使用者

就一個 https 的 server 然後 return 301 http://zxy.***

就行301 或者 302

nginx 裡除了 listen 加 ssl , http 和 https 伺服器沒有區別

如何為nginx配置https

5樓:匿名使用者

申請https證書

在nginx配置檔案中新增一個serverserver裡面監聽443埠,並新增ssl引數配置證書位置,最後重啟nginx即可

6樓:匿名使用者

nginx安裝ssl證書:

nginx 自動跳轉到

7樓:匿名使用者

預設情況下ssl模組並未被安裝,如果要使用該模組則需要在編譯時指定–with-http_ssl_module引數,安裝模組依賴於openssl庫和一些引用檔案,通常這些檔案並不在同一個軟體包中。通常這個檔名類似libssl-dev。

生成證書

可以通過以下步驟生成一個簡單的證書:

首先,進入你想建立證書和私鑰的目錄,例如:

$ cd /usr/local/nginx/conf

建立伺服器私鑰,命令會讓你輸入一個口令:

$ openssl genrsa -des3 -out server.key 1024

建立簽名請求的證書(csr):

$ openssl req -new -key server.key -out server.csr

在載入ssl支援的nginx並使用上述私鑰時除去必須的口令:

$ cp server.key server.key.***

$ openssl rsa -in server.key.*** -out server.key

配置nginx

最後標記證書使用上述私鑰和csr:

$ openssl x509 -req -days 365 -in server.csr -signkey server.key -out server.crt

修改nginx配置檔案,讓其包含新標記的證書和私鑰:

server

重啟nginx。

這樣就可以通過以下方式訪問:

另外還可以加入如下**實現80埠重定向到443it人樂園

server

nginx指向https怎麼配置

8樓:光網

https,您需要先淘一個https證書(正規合法的)並且按照以下教程操作:

nginx安裝ssl證書

nginx 自動跳轉到

nginx如何同時配置https和wss?

9樓:賊貓

nginx同時配置https和wss**如下:

server

location /ws

}websocket協議的握手和http是相容的,它使用http的upgrade協議頭將連線從http連線升級到websocket連線。這個特性使得websocket應用程式可以很容易地應用到現有的基礎設施。就可以使用https//+域名訪問和使用wss:

//+域名+/ws訪問了

如何用 nginx 配置透明 http 和 https **

10樓:匿名使用者

nginx ("engine x") 是一個高效能的 http 和 反向** 伺服器,也是一個 imap/pop3/**tp **伺服器。 nginx 是由 igor sysoev 為俄羅斯訪問量第二的 rambler.ru 站點開發的,,因它的穩定性、豐富的功能集、示例配置檔案和低系統資源的消耗而聞名。

1、首先需要配置站點的wosign ssl證書開啟nginx安裝目錄下conf目錄中的nginx.conf檔案 找到

#} 將其修改為 :

server

} 儲存退出,並重啟nginx。

通過https方式訪問您的站點,測試站點證書的安裝配置。

3、配置強身份認證

1、 修改nginx.conf檔案

如果要求客戶採用客戶證書認證方式,可以在原來的配置下增加如下引數:

server

4、重啟站點使用您的客戶端證書進行登陸測試

11樓:匿名使用者

http**存在兩種。

一種是基於rfc 7230 以及其他相關rfc文件中描述的普通**,**伺服器充當的是一箇中間的元件,通過在請求uri設定的對應authority來指定目標伺服器。

另一種是基於rfc 2817實現的tcp隧道**。與上面的區別就在於「tcp隧道」,這種**可以以http協議的方式來實現理論上任意tcp之上的應用層協議**,兩端之間的通訊都是在http的body部分完成的。因此就可以完成基於tls的https通訊,被加密過的資料直接在body中傳輸。

nginx不支援第二種**,因此不能完成https**。nginx的作者對於這個功能有明確的回覆,表示不會在近期實現,並且推薦使用squid。

帝國cms怎麼生成偽靜態頁面分頁號

如果說你是在搞url的話 本來就可以訪問分頁url不需要生成,如果你是說怎麼給欄目頁面翻頁的時候在標題加一個當前頁面分頁號那麼就得用這個標籤呼叫 list.pageno 帝國cms 偽靜態後臺怎麼設定 帝國cms 偽靜態後臺設定方法 1 在 根目錄 web資料夾 下建一個檔案,檔名及字尾格式為 ht...

cisoc思科怎麼配置VTY介面使用本地使用者名稱與密碼進行登

vty是虛擬遠端登入埠,用user3登入之後可以檢視路由器show version配置檔案 思科伺服器怎麼配置登入名和登入密碼 router enable 進入配置模 式router config terminal 進入特權模式 router config hostname r1 更改裝置名稱為r1...

pycharm第一次使用怎麼配置

linux系統是復非常穩定和高效的制,對電腦硬體配置要求很低,這正是linux系統的優勢所在,不同的linux系統版本要求略有不同,但是大體上在同一個配置等級內,而且當下主流的配置都可以輕鬆執行linux系統,使用者可以參考如下ubuntu的配置求 一 ubuntu的最低配置 在外觀首選項裡關閉特殊...